At Medtronic, our mission is to alleviate pain, restore health, and extend life.

To support the continued growth and transformation of Service & Repair (S&R) EMEA, we are establishing an Equipment Lifecycle Management (ELM) organization that brings together the Tooling and Calibration teams in one strategically aligned function.

As Manager, Equipment Lifecycle Management, you will lead the integration and development of this new regional organization. You will be accountable for the availability, compliance, reliability, visibility, and lifecycle performance of the tooling, test equipment, calibration assets, and supporting infrastructure that enable service delivery across EMEA.

You will establish the team’s operating model, governance, performance standards, and culture. You will also drive process standardization, supplier optimization, digitalization, continuous improvement, and capability development, working closely with regional and global partners to support service readiness and sustainable growth.
